## Restoring soft-deleted rows in the Marrowgate orders table

Orders in Marrowgate are never hard-deleted during business hours; the `deleted_at` column is set instead. To recover an account's orders, first confirm the deletion window with the requester, then run the restore script in dry-run mode and review the row count carefully. Only proceed if the count matches the ticket. The restore script prompts for the vault recovery passphrase, which is recorded directly below this paragraph.

unlock words, hahip-baduf: holwyn-istath-julvan

Quarterly Planning Note — Inventory Write-down

Heads up for planning: we're writing down the remaining Glimworth v2 units this quarter — they've been gathering dust since the v3 launch. Expect a one-time hit to gross margin of a few points; cash impact is nil. Please bake this into your Q2 models before Friday. Some confidential context on the bigger picture follows below.

confidential, kagup-bafog: Fraaxax Group is in early talks to buy Soroxox Group for about $343.8 million. The Olidor launch date is June 14, and nothing goes to the press before then. Legal wants the Aldmirek Logistics term sheet signed before July 23.

// MAX_CRON_DRIFT_SECONDS caps acceptable scheduler drift observed
// during the Quillbarrow investigation. Jobs on the Fennick fleet
// fired up to 38s late after a kernel upgrade changed timer
// coalescing; 45s gives headroom without masking real faults.
// Security review note: values above this trigger an audit event,
// not a silent retry. The investigation's reference build token
// follows below.

session token of tajef-bageg = htk21_5d90d574934f3ccae6437

Ticket: BRV-2214 — Config drift found during stale-cache postmortem

While writing up last week's stale-cache incident on Quillstone, we found prod cache TTLs diverged from the committed manifest — someone hot-patched them in March and never merged back. This masked the invalidation bug for weeks. Action: reconcile prod with source, add drift alerting. Values currently live in prod are captured below.

service settings:
[casax]
port = 6379
team = rusir
host = casax.zemvarhq.corp
region = outer-4
access_code = ac_9808ce
timeout_ms = 1500